Presbyterian Plays Chattanooga on the Road

The Presbyterian Blue Hose (3-3) travel to Tennessee to play the Chattanooga Mocs (4-5) on Sunday, March 1, at 10 a.m. at the UTC Tennis Center.
 
A LOOK AT THE BLUE HOSE
Presbyterian coach Juan Pablo Boada is in his second season at the helm of the program. Presbyterian returned three letterwinners: senior David Mamalat and sophomores Daksh Prasad and Eduardo Valentin. Joining those three returners are newcomers junior Matija Samardzic, sophomore Gabriel Godoy, and freshmen Thomas Anderson, Victor Mayer, and Dario Navarro.  This fall, Mamalat and Samardzic captured the doubles title at the Big South Individual Championship and advanced to the quarterfinals of the ITA Conference Masters Championship. Every Blue Hose posted singles and doubles wins during the fall's tournament season.
 
This spring, Valentin, Mamalat, Navarro, and Prasad have all tallied three singles wins.  The doubles tandem of Mamalat and Samardzic has tallied four wins this spring.
 
LAST TIME OUT
Presbyterian captured the doubles point with wins on courts one and two in a 4-3 road win on February 17. Presbyterian's Mamalat, Prasad, and Navarro captured singles wins.
 
BIG SOUTH FRESHMAN OF THE WEEK
Navarro was named the Big South Conference Freshman of the Week this week. Navarro was the 20th player in the program's history to earn the Big South Freshman of the Week award. Navarro played an integral role in helping the Blue Hose beat Wofford, 4-3, on the road on February 17. At number two doubles, he teamed with Anderson to post a 6-4 win, which clinched the doubles point for the Blue Hose. Then, he clinched the overall victory for the Blue Hose with PC's fourth win of the match with a 6-2, 6-4 victory at number five singles.
 
BIG SOUTH PRESEASON POLL
Presbyterian was picked to finish third in the preseason Big South coaches poll. Longwood was picked to win the Big South title in the preseason poll.
 
In Presbyterian's men's tennis program's history, the Blue Hose have captured three Big South regular-season titles (2014, 2017, and 2023) and three Big South Tournament titles (2017, 2021, and 2023).
 
SCOUTING CHATTANOOGA
Sunday's match will be the tenth meeting between Presbyterian and Chattanooga, with Chattanooga leading the series 5-4. The Mocs have won the last two meetings between the two teams, including a 5-2 win at PC on March 2, 2025. Mamalat and Prasad tallied singles wins in that match.
 
Chattanooga enters Sunday's match after victories over Toledo and Austin Peay this week.
